How Kyle Wright has stabilized Braves starting rotation

92.9 The Game Braves insider Grant McAuley joined Dukes & Bell for his normal appearance to talk some Braves with the guys and talked about how has Kyle Wright stabilized the Braves starting rotation.

When asked about Wright’s performance so far this season.


“I feel like he’s been one of the top ten or fifteen pitchers in the National League at the very least, and if you go look at the strikeouts, the era, the wins, the old standard pitching triple crown categories he’s been one of the twenty best pitchers in major league baseball this year,” McAuley said. “You can throw wins above replacement in there as well because he grades out all across the board. He generates a lot of soft contact, he doesn’t walk very many hitters, he pounds the strike zone, he makes adjustments in games.”

McAuley talked about how Wright has stabilized the rotation.

“He has stabilized this rotation, he’s one of very few pitchers, I believe it’s half a dozen Braves pitchers since 2000 that have one ten or more games in the first half of the season. He has put himself in some pretty good, that’s a list that includes Tom Glavine and Greg Maddux and guys of that nature. If your name is on that list as a Braves pitcher you have done a few things right, if you’ll pardon the pun.”
